Lever #1: Supplier Relationship Management (SRM)

Supplier relationship management (SRM) is a crucial lever for optimizing the manufacturing supply chain. Building strong and collaborative relationships with suppliers can lead to numerous benefits, including increased cost savings, improved product quality, enhanced innovation, and reduced supply chain risks.

To effectively manage supplier relationships, it’s important to establish clear communication channels and foster open dialogue. Regular meetings and performance reviews can help ensure alignment on expectations and address any potential issues proactively. By maintaining a transparent and mutually beneficial relationship with suppliers, procurement teams can build trust and drive long-term success.

Another key aspect of SRM is supplier selection. It’s essential to evaluate potential suppliers based on criteria such as price competitiveness, delivery capabilities, quality standards, ethical practices, and financial stability. Conducting thorough due diligence before entering into contracts helps mitigate risks associated with unreliable or unethical suppliers.

Furthermore, implementing performance metrics and monitoring systems enables procurement teams to track supplier performance effectively. This allows for timely identification of any deviations from agreed-upon terms or KPIs. Lever #2: Sourcing and Contracting

Sourcing and contracting play a crucial role in optimizing the manufacturing supply chain. By strategically selecting suppliers and negotiating contracts, companies can achieve cost savings, improve quality control, and enhance overall efficiency.

When it comes to sourcing, organizations need to carefully evaluate potential suppliers based on various factors such as price, quality, reliability, and responsiveness. Conducting thorough research and gathering feedback from industry peers can help identify reliable partners who align with the company’s goals.

Once suitable suppliers are identified, the next step is to negotiate contracts that protect both parties’ interests. Contracts should outline clear expectations regarding pricing terms, delivery schedules, product specifications, and performance metrics. Effective contract management ensures transparency and minimizes risks associated with non-compliance or disputes.

Collaboration between procurement teams and other departments is essential during the sourcing process. Close coordination helps ensure that all stakeholders’ requirements are considered when selecting suppliers. Additionally, involving cross-functional teams can lead to innovative solutions that drive competitive advantage.

Regularly reviewing supplier performance is vital for maintaining strong relationships over time. Monitoring metrics like on-time deliveries or defect rates enables organizations to address any issues promptly while also identifying opportunities for improvement.

Lever #3: Spend Analysis and Optimization

Spend analysis and optimization play a crucial role in optimizing the manufacturing supply chain. By carefully analyzing spending patterns, businesses can identify opportunities to reduce costs and improve efficiency.

One way to optimize spend is by identifying areas of overspending or unnecessary expenses. This involves conducting a thorough analysis of all procurement activities, including vendor contracts, purchase orders, and invoices. By closely examining these documents, businesses can uncover any discrepancies or inefficiencies that may be driving up costs.

Another important aspect of spend analysis is supplier consolidation. By reducing the number of suppliers used for procurement purposes, businesses can negotiate better deals and leverage their buying power. This not only reduces costs but also streamlines the procurement process.

Furthermore, implementing cost-effective sourcing strategies is essential for spend optimization. This includes evaluating alternative sources for materials and components, as well as exploring new technologies or innovative solutions that may offer cost savings.

In addition to analyzing spending patterns, it’s important to continuously monitor and track key performance indicators (KPIs) related to procurement. These KPIs provide valuable insights into the effectiveness of purchasing decisions and help identify areas where improvements can be made.

Lever #4: Inventory Management and Optimization

Lever #4: Inventory Management and Optimization

Keeping track of inventory is a crucial aspect of any manufacturing supply chain. Effective inventory management ensures that the right products are available at the right time, minimizing both stockouts and excess inventory. It’s all about finding that delicate balance.

One way to optimize inventory management is through demand forecasting. By analyzing historical data and market trends, procurement teams can predict future demand more accurately. This helps in planning production schedules and preventing overstocking or understocking situations.

Another important aspect of inventory optimization is implementing an efficient replenishment strategy. This involves setting appropriate reorder points and order quantities based on lead times, demand variability, and service levels required by customers.

Furthermore, adopting Just-in-Time (JIT) principles can significantly improve efficiency in managing inventories. JIT aims to minimize waste by having materials arrive just when they are needed in the production process, reducing carrying costs associated with excess stock.

Additionally, implementing a robust tracking system using technology like barcoding or RFID tags enables real-time visibility into inventory levels across multiple locations. This allows for better coordination between suppliers, manufacturers, and distributors to ensure seamless flow throughout the supply chain.

Regular monitoring and analysis of key performance indicators (KPIs) related to inventory management can help identify areas for improvement. Metrics such as turnover ratio, fill rate percentage, and obsolete stock rate provide valuable insights into overall performance.

Lever #5: Transportation Management and Optimization

Transportation management plays a crucial role in optimizing the manufacturing supply chain. Efficient transportation ensures that goods are delivered on time, reducing delays and minimizing costs. To optimize this lever of procurement, companies can employ various strategies.

One approach is to streamline the transportation network by consolidating shipments and using intermodal transportation options when possible. This reduces empty miles and maximizes vehicle capacity utilization, resulting in cost savings and reduced carbon footprint.

Another strategy is to leverage technology solutions such as Transportation Management Systems (TMS). These systems provide real-time visibility into shipment status, route optimization capabilities, and data analytics for informed decision-making. By utilizing TMS software, companies can improve efficiency, track performance metrics, and identify areas for improvement within their transportation operations.

Collaboration with carriers is also vital for effective transportation management. Building strong relationships with reliable carriers allows for better coordination of schedules and routes while negotiating favorable rates based on volume commitments.

In addition to these strategies, continuous monitoring of key performance indicators (KPIs) helps identify bottlenecks or inefficiencies in the transportation process. KPIs such as on-time delivery percentage, freight cost per unit shipped, or carrier performance metrics enable companies to make data-driven decisions for optimization.

Lever #6: Data Analytics and Reporting

Lever #6: Data Analytics and Reporting

In today’s fast-paced manufacturing landscape, data analytics and reporting have become invaluable tools for optimizing procurement processes. By harnessing the power of data, manufacturers can gain valuable insights into their supply chain operations, identify areas for improvement, and make informed decisions to drive efficiency.

Data analytics allows procurement professionals to analyze vast amounts of historical purchasing data to identify patterns, trends, and anomalies. This enables them to understand which suppliers consistently deliver high-quality products on time and at competitive prices. By leveraging this information, manufacturers can build stronger relationships with reliable suppliers and negotiate favorable terms.

Furthermore, data analytics can help identify potential bottlenecks in the supply chain by analyzing lead times, order quantities, and delivery schedules. Armed with this knowledge, manufacturers can proactively address any issues that may arise before they impact production or customer satisfaction.

Reporting plays a crucial role in communicating these findings effectively across different departments within an organization. It provides stakeholders with clear visibility into key performance indicators (KPIs), allowing them to monitor supplier performance metrics such as on-time delivery rates or product quality scores.

By utilizing robust reporting tools integrated with their procurement systems, manufacturers can generate real-time reports that provide actionable insights for continuous improvement strategies. These reports facilitate collaboration between different teams involved in the supply chain process by providing them with accurate information needed to make informed decisions quickly.
